GULU - Thousands Sunday (November 20, 2022) graced the beatification of Fr. Dr Giuseppe (Joseph) Ambrosoli at Sacred Heart of Jesus Kalongo Catholic Parish in Gulu Archdiocese.

The mass was led by Apostolic Nuncio to Uganda Archbishop Luigi Bianco, assisted by Gulu Archbishop John Baptist Odama.

In his message, Pope Francis described blessed Fr. Dr Ambrosoli as a man of prayers who dedicated himself as a servant of God and worked hard to treat the poor of Acholi region in northern Uganda.

The Pope said Ambrosoli worked tirelessly in the Archdiocese of Gulu in Acholi land and left a legacy that everyone should emulate for their faith to grow.

President Yoweri Museveni attended the ceremony, saying he was happy to represent the government at the beatification of Fr. Ambrosolli and thanked Pope Francis and the Catholic Church for recognizing the special work he did in Uganda.

Museveni said religious missionaries started coming to Africa and although some were hypocrites, many were good including Fr. Ambrosolli who brought good messages to Africa and Uganda in particular.

The President also commended Fr. Ambrosolli for healing people, teaching the word of God and working in a remote place, leaving the comfort of his home in Italy although he was well qualified and would have chosen to work from home.
